> > When I run evince from a terminal, I get the following annoying
> > Gtk-WARNING messages:
> > 
> > (evince:25632): Gtk-WARNING **: Failed to get the GNOME session proxy: The name org.gnome.SessionManager is not owned
> > 
> > (evince:25632): Gtk-WARNING **: Failed to get the Xfce session proxy: The name org.xfce.SessionManager is not owned
> > 
> > (evince:25632): Gtk-WARNING **: Failed to get an inhibit portal proxy: The name org.freedesktop.portal.Desktop is not owned
> > 
> > For the first two, this is completely stupid: I use neither GNOME,
> > nor Xfce! I don't know about the third one (I just use fvwm as my
> > window manager).
> 
> evince tries to access those D-Bus services. As they are not provided in
> your environment, evince logs those errors.
> 
> This is not a bug.

Since there are errors, there is a bug. So, I assume that the bug is
in fvwm.
